Weekend Race Recap
Friday 7:30 p.m. - A huge crowd at Ocala Speedway Friday night saw first hand just how competative today's Monster Jam action is when the four competitions at the central Florida venue were won by four different Monster Jam superstars to kick off a four-event weekend.
Opening the action with the Wheelie Competition Randy Brown hit a pair of huge sky wheelies to take the weekend's first victory. Then on to racing on a J-hook style track on the infield of the race track that was converted from asphalt to dirt in the year since Monster Jam last saw action there. Grave Digger won the opening race over Mopar Magic, but a broken brake rotor would eliminate Randy Brown's Digger from the race bracket anyway as several crews pitched in to get Grave Digger fixed for the night's other competitions. Gunslinger replace Digger in round two, but Steve Sims in Stone Crusher knocked off Scott Hartsock's big Ford in the semifinals. The other semifinal saw local favorite Bruce Haney drive Bad News to victory over Carl Van Horn in Mopar Magic to set up a Stone Crusher vs. Bad News Championship Race. The finale was close from start to finish with Stone Crusher pulling out a one truck length victory for the racing win.
Next up was the donut contest, which was very close with every Monster Jam competitor thrilling the crowd with their own versions of cyclone style donuts. In the end the judges scored the win for Bad News, no surprise since Haney has dominated donut contest at Thunder National events for year.
With three competitions in the books and no wins yet for Grave Digger Brown let it all hang out in freestyle, where the last track surface gave the black and green wrecking machine plenty of room to manuever, and Brown sailed Grave Digger over every thing in sight, getting the biggest air of the event and keeping Grave Digger on the ragged edge throughout the run to win the first freestyle competition of the weekend in Ocala.

Saturday 2:00 p.m. - Rising Monster Jam star Steve Sims drove Stone Crusher to the racing championship for the second straight day and Randy Brown again rocked north central Florida with a winning Grave Digger freestyle perfromance Saturday afternoon at Ocala Speedway.
The action packed event opened with a wild wheelie contest, where Randy Moore got the win in War Wizard but crashed the futuristic Willys at the end of the wheelie, the truck suffering substantial rear end damage and would not be able to come back for the other competitions during the matinee on a beautiful Florida afternoon.
The racing bracket Saturday afternoon played out much like it did Friday night, with Sims and Florida native Bruce Haney in Bad News earning the slots in the Championship Race. In the final race again it was Stone Crusher with just a little more than Bad News coming to the finish, and Sims had recorded his second straight event racing triumph.
In a mild surprise Grave Digger upset vaunted donut specialist Bad News in the donut contest, then it was on to freestyle where the Monster Jam superstars took advantage of the huge space on the dirt track surface and several added obstacles to put on a high flying exhibition that included several huge slap wheelie and even more crowd pleasing cyclone donuts. In the end it was Brown who had more of the sic air and wild cyclones, plus a length of the front stretch slap wheelie that took home the freestyle win once again for Team Grave Digger.

Saturday 7:30 p.m. - With a huge standing room only crowd of enthusiastic fans packing into Ocala Speedway Randy Brown turned the wick on Grave Digger up even higher, dominating the competition to sweep all four events Saturday night on the newly redesigned dirt track in north central Florida.
Brown served notice that Grave Digger brought the "A" game Saturday night from the start, where he ended War Wizard's two event win streak in the wheelie competition. Brown followed a huge sky wheelie by powering Grave Digger immediately into one of the weekend's best slap wheelies to grab the win according to the three fans serving as judges, and frankly, according to the rest of the capacity crowd as well.
Having ended Randy Moore and War Wizard's run in wheelies, next Brown would seek to stop Steve Sims' racing momentum. Sims had driven his Stone Crusher Ford to the racing win in the weekend's first two brackets, but that ended Saturday night when Brown found some Grave Digger magic on the fast, tricky race course. Grave Digger got Stone Crusher out of the way in the semifinals when Brown edged Sims at the finish line, the Grave Digger beat Florida hero Scott Hartsock and Gunslinger in the Championship Race.
Two wins down, two more to go as the event hit the half way mark, and Brown proved to be up to the challenge. Grave Digger's lengthy cyclone style donuts netted Brown his third win of the night, and Grave Digger was on a roll heading into the Freestyle Competition. The bar was set high for the Digger, especially with crowd pleasing performances from War Wizard and Stone Crusher, but Brown was up to the challenge and put on the best freestyle of the exciting weekend so far, Grave Digger completing the Saturday night sweep of all four competitions.

Sunday 2:00 p.m. - Steve Sims drove his Stone Crusher Ford to the racing win for the third time this weekend while Randy Brown completed a weekend sweep of all four freestyle competitions in Grave Digger Sunday afternoon at Ocala Speedway.
Showing the large Florida crowd why his team earned the 2008 Monster Jam Team of the Year honors, Sims won the day's first two battles, winning the wheelie contest for the first time this weekend, and then rolling to another racing event championship. In the Championship Race Sims beat his other team truck, Mopar Magic, being driven by Floridian Lionel Easler. Easler was subbing for Carl Van Horn, who aggrivated a shoulder injury in Saturday afternoon's event and was able to continue working on the trucks, but stepped out of the driver's seat for the final two events on the hot Florida weekend. Landing across the finish line with the racing win against Mopar Magic Stone Crusher broke a front sway bar, so Sims' crew began thrashing to get Stone Crusher back in time for freestyle.
That meant Stone Crusher would not compete in the donut contest, but Sims' teammate picked up the slack as Easler won that contest in Mopar Magic. Brown then made sure that the Sims' team would not get a clean sweep of Sunday's action when he powered Grave Digger through another high energy freestyle that was a winner according to the scoring of the three fans serving as judges to give the black and green wrecking machine a clean sweep of all four freestyles held at Ocala Speedway this weekend.
